BASF India’s parent firm to buy Germany’s Chemetall for $3.2 billion

BASF SE of Germany signs agreement to acquire chemical firm Albemarle's global surface treatment business of its unit Chemetall for $3.2 bn

Mumbai: Specialty chemicals maker BASF India Ltd on Wednesday said its parent company BASF SE of Germany has signed an agreement to acquire chemical firm Albemarle Corp.’s global surface treatment business of its unit Chemetall Gmbh for $3.2 billion.

This international transaction is subject to approval by the relevant authorities and is expected to close by the end of 2016.

In India, Chemetall operates through its subsidiary, Chemetall India Pvt. Ltd, which generated sales of $24 million in 2015 and has around 150 employees.

The products of Chemetall complements BASF’s current portfolio by adding surface treatment business of its coatings offerings, BASF India said in a statement.

In India, the coatings business is a part of the ‘Functional Material & Solutions’ segment of BASF India.

Chemetall, headquartered in Frankfurt, has approximately 2,500 employees globally and operates 21 production sites in more than 20 countries, as well as 10 research and development locations and 24 sales offices.

For the calendar year 2015, global sales of Chemetall were $845 million.

The chemicals manufactured by Chemetall are used in a wide range of industries and by end-users, primarily automotive, aerospace, coil and metal forming.
